Of this, $540,085 represents the investment in capital assets, leaving <br />unrestricted net position of $570,915. <br />Operating revenue in the Sewer Fund increased $22,048 from the prior year, due to increased sewer <br />access fees in the current year. <br />Sewer Fund operating expenses for 2024 increased $17,583 from the previous year. The increase is due to <br />an increase in Metropolitan Council Environmental Services charges in the current year. <br />BEII <br />
